Heim >Backend-Entwicklung >PHP-Problem >Wie man Arrays in PHP zu String-Arrays verkettet
Das Konvertieren eines Arrays in ein String-Array ist eine sehr häufige Aufgabe in PHP. Durch diesen Vorgang kann das Programm Daten effizienter verwalten und mehrere Datenelemente können für komplexere Vorgänge kombiniert werden. Nachfolgend werden einige gängige Methoden beschrieben.
Methode 1: Verwenden Sie die Funktion implode()
PHPs Funktion implode() kann die String-Elemente im Array zu einem String kombinieren und sie durch bestimmte Trennzeichen trennen. Hier ist ein Beispiel:
$myArray = array("Hello", "World", "PHP", "is", "Great"); $string = implode(", ", $myArray); echo $string;
Die obige Codeausgabe:
Hello, World, PHP, is, Great
Methode 2: Verwenden Sie die Funktion „join()“
Ähnlich wie die Funktion „implode()“ kann die Funktion „join()“ auch Zeichenfolgenelemente im Array zu einem kombinieren Zeichenfolge. Der einzige Unterschied besteht in der Reihenfolge seiner Parameter. Hier ist ein Beispiel:
$myArray = array("Hello", "World", "PHP", "is", "Great"); $string = join(", ", $myArray); echo $string;
Die obige Codeausgabe:
Hello, World, PHP, is, Great
Obwohl diese beiden Funktionen die gleiche Funktionalität implementieren, unterscheidet sich ihre Parameterreihenfolge geringfügig. Meistens bevorzugen Programmierer die Funktion implode(), da diese besser lesbar ist.
Methode 3: Manuelles Spleißen von Strings
In PHP ist das manuelle Spleißen von Strings eine gängige Methode. Sie können eine Schleife verwenden, um das Array zu durchlaufen und jedes Element zur Zeichenfolge hinzuzufügen. Hier ist ein Beispiel:
$myArray = array("Hello", "World", "PHP", "is", "Great"); $string = ""; for($i = 0; $i < count($myArray); $i++) { $string .= $myArray[$i]; if ($i != count($myArray) - 1) { $string .= ", "; } } echo $string;
Die obige Codeausgabe:
Hello, World, PHP, is, Great
Diese Methode kann das Format der Zeichenfolge durch Schleifen anpassen.
Zusammenfassung
Das Konvertieren eines Arrays in ein String-Array ist eine häufig von PHP-Programmierern durchgeführte Aufgabe. Glücklicherweise bietet PHP mehrere Funktionen, um diese Aufgabe zu erfüllen. Sie können die Funktionen implode() oder join() verwenden, um einen String zu bilden, oder Sie können Strings manuell verketten, um Ihnen die vollständige Kontrolle über das Format der Ausgabe zu geben.
Das obige ist der detaillierte Inhalt vonWie man Arrays in PHP zu String-Arrays verkettet.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!